how to start a water treatment business

Starting a water treatment business can be a lucrative venture that not only helps provide clean and safe water to communities but also contributes to environmental sustainability. However, like any business, starting a water treatment company requires careful planning and execution. In this comprehensive guide, we will walk you through the fundamental steps to launch your own successful water treatment business.

1. Conduct Market Research

Before diving into the water treatment business, it’s essential to conduct thorough market research. Identify your target market, understand the demand for water treatment services in the area, and analyze your competitors. This research will help you determine the viability of your business idea and develop a solid business strategy.

2. Develop a Business Plan

A well-thought-out business plan is crucial for the success of your water treatment business. Outline your business goals, target market, services offered, pricing strategy, marketing plan, and financial projections. Your business plan will serve as a roadmap to guide your business operations and attract potential investors or lenders.

3. Obtain Necessary Licenses and Permits

Compliance with local and state regulations is paramount when starting a water treatment business. Obtain the required licenses and permits to operate legally. Additionally, consider getting certified by relevant industry organizations to demonstrate your expertise and credibility in water treatment.

4. Invest in High-Quality Equipment

The success of your water treatment business largely depends on the quality of equipment you use. Invest in high-quality water treatment systems, filtration units, and testing equipment to ensure effective and reliable water treatment services. Regular maintenance and upgrades are essential to maintain the efficiency of your equipment.

5. Hire Skilled Staff

Building a team of skilled professionals is essential for delivering superior water treatment services. Hire experienced water treatment specialists, technicians, and support staff who are well-versed in water treatment technologies and regulations. Provide ongoing training to keep your team updated on the latest industry trends.

6. Develop a Marketing Strategy

Promote your water treatment business through various marketing channels to reach your target audience. Utilize digital marketing techniques such as social media, search engine optimization, and email marketing to increase brand awareness and attract clients. Networking with local businesses and organizations can also help generate leads.

7. Focus on Customer Service

Providing exceptional customer service is key to building a loyal customer base and growing your water treatment business. Prioritize customer satisfaction, respond promptly to inquiries and concerns, and strive to exceed customer expectations. Positive reviews and referrals can greatly benefit your business reputation.

8. Expand Your Services

As your water treatment business grows, consider expanding your service offerings to meet the evolving needs of your customers. Explore new technologies, such as wastewater treatment or water recycling, to diversify your business and stay ahead of the competition. Adapt to market trends and continuously innovate to stay relevant in the industry.

9. Embrace Sustainability Practices

Environmental sustainability is a growing concern in the water treatment industry. Implement eco-friendly practices in your business operations, such as reducing water wastage, using energy-efficient equipment, and promoting water conservation. Showcase your commitment to sustainability to attract environmentally-conscious customers.

10. Monitor Industry Trends

Stay informed about the latest developments and trends in the water treatment industry to position your business for success. Attend industry conferences, seminars, and trade shows to network with industry experts and stay updated on emerging technologies and regulations. Continuous learning and adaptation are essential for long-term success.

Conclusion

Starting a water treatment business requires careful planning, investment in quality equipment, skilled staff, and a strong focus on customer service. By following the steps outlined in this guide and staying abreast of industry trends, you can establish a successful and sustainable water treatment business that makes a positive impact on society and the environment.
